Radiopharmaceuticals are a unique category of medicinal formulations containing radioisotopes that are used in the field of nuclear medicine. These compounds, which are characterized by their ability to emit radiation, serve multiple purposes, including diagnosis, therapy, and research. Radiopharmaceuticals offer significant value in both the detection and treatment of disease, enhancing the capability for early diagnosis, monitoring of disease progression, and effectiveness of therapeutic interventions. Radiopharmaceutical compounds are experiencing significant adoption, driven by the rising prevalence of chronic diseases such as cancer and cardiovascular disorders that require advanced diagnostic techniques. Technological advancements in imaging technologies, such as PET and SPECT, are also catalyzing the radiopharmaceuticals market growth. Additionally, the increasing adoption of personalized medicine and targeted therapy approaches boosts the demand for radioisotopes in therapeutic applications. Despite considerable growth prospects, the radiopharmaceuticals market faces challenges, including stringent regulatory requirements that result in longer approval times for new radiopharmaceuticals. High costs for radiopharmaceutical development and production, as well as the requirement for specialized facilities and trained personnel, add to the list of challenges facing the industry. However, the increasing investment in research and development provides ample opportunities for innovation and expansion in the radiopharmaceutical market. Furthermore, ongoing advancements in theranostics, which combine diagnostic and therapeutic capabilities in a single agent, present new avenues for integrative healthcare solutions and personalized treatment, positioning the radiopharmaceuticals market for sustained growth.
The radiopharmaceutical market in the Americas has shown robust growth, driven by advancements in nuclear medicine and the advanced healthcare infrastructure. The United States contributes majorly to the market with its substantial investments in R&D and favorable reimbursement policies. Canada and Latin America are also experiencing growth, albeit at a slower pace, owing to increasing awareness and improving healthcare facilities. Europe is a significant contributor to the radiopharmaceutical market within the EMEA region, with adoption fuelled by the rising incidence of chronic illnesses, the aging population, and increased healthcare expenditure. Germany, France, and the UK have strong market positions due to their advanced healthcare systems and supportive government initiatives. The Middle East and Africa are emerging markets with untapped potential, characterized by increasing investment in healthcare infrastructure and a growing demand for diagnostic services. However, the scarcity of skilled professionals and economic variability across countries may challenge market expansion in this region. The Asia-Pacific radiopharmaceutical market is experiencing rapid growth, offering substantial opportunities due to its strong research base in evolving healthcare sectors. Countries such as China, Japan, Australia, and South Korea are at the forefront of this growth. The increasing government initiatives to modernize healthcare are propelling market development.

Based on Type, market is studied across Diagnostic Nuclear Medicine and Therapeutic Nuclear Medicine. The Diagnostic Nuclear Medicine is further studied across Pet Radiopharmaceuticals and Spect Radiopharmaceuticals. The Pet Radiopharmaceuticals is further studied across F-18 and Ru-82. The Spect Radiopharmaceuticals is further studied across Ga-67, I-123, Tc-99m, and Tl-201. The Therapeutic Nuclear Medicine is further studied across Alpha Emitters, Beta Emitters, and Brachytherapy Isotopes. The Beta Emitters is further studied across I-131, Lu-177, Re-186, Sm-153, and Y-90. The Brachytherapy Isotopes is further studied across Cs-131, I-125, Ir-192, and Pd-103. The Therapeutic Nuclear Medicine commanded largest market share of 60.03% in 2023, followed by Diagnostic Nuclear Medicine.
